Michael, one of nine siblings, grew up across the street from Visitation School, where he attended grade school, and later graduated from Hogan High School.
A plumber by trade, Michael owned and operated his own plumbing company for many years, faithfully serving customers throughout the Kansas City area. His strong work ethic and dedication to his craft were well known and deeply appreciated by those who relied on his services.
Michael was preceded in death by his beloved wife, Darleen Henninger, and his children, Charlie Henninger and Sally Henninger. He is survived by his son, Michael Henninger; his daughters, Lauren (Adam) Welsh and Stacy Henninger; and his cherished grandchildren, John, Lily, Joseph, Graham, and Harper.
Michael was known for his strong presence, candid nature, and unmistakable personality. He left a lasting impression on everyone he met, and stories shared among friends and family often reflect the moments that made him so memorable. Later in life, he developed a passion for photography, earning awards for his work, with one of his photographs featured on the banner proudly displayed during the Plaza Duck Derby.
Michael will be laid to rest beside his wife, Darleen, in a private family burial.
